Man Dies After Being Struck by Train at Haymarket
Orange Line trains were evacuated near Haymarket station Wednesday evening after a man was struck and trapped under a train. He later died from his injuries at a nearby hospital.
Firefighters were able to pull the victim to safety after he was struck by the train around 5:30 p.m. It’s not yet clear why the man, described by police as “in his 40s,’’ was on the tracks. MBTA Transit Police continue to investigate the circumstances of the incident.

Passengers were evacuated from stuck trains after responders cut power to the third rail.
Normal service has since resumed.
